Understanding Cut-Resistant Gloves
Cut-resistant gloves are designed to protect hands from cuts, abrasions, and punctures when handling sharp objects. Various industries, such as manufacturing, construction, and food preparation, require employees to wear these gloves to minimize the risk of injury. The effectiveness of a cut-resistant glove is determined by its material, construction, and the ANSI/ISEA 105 test cut level rating.
Why Choose Aramid Fiber?
Aramid fibers, such as Kevlar, have earned a reputation for their exceptional strength and durability. When used in cut-resistant gloves, these fibers provide a higher level of protection compared to standard materials like cotton or leather. In 2025, aramid gloves are at the forefront of safety gear due to their lightweight nature and outstanding heat resistance.
Key Characteristics of Aramid Gloves
1. High Cut Resistance: Gloves made with aramid fibers exhibit remarkable tear and cut resistance, making them suitable for handling sharp tools and materials.
2. Lightweight and Comfortable: Unlike some other materials, aramid fibers can maintain a level of comfort, allowing workers to perform tasks without feeling weighed down.
3. Heat Resistant: In addition to cut protection, aramid fibers also withstand high temperatures, offering an extra layer of safety in environments where heat is a factor.
4. Flexibility: Aramid gloves offer excellent dexterity, allowing hands to move freely while still receiving superior protection.

Cut Level Ratings
Cut level ratings provide a straightforward way to assess the protective abilities of gloves. The American National Standards Institute (ANSI) has established a scale from A1 to A9, with higher numbers representing increased cut resistance. For example, an A4-rated glove is suitable for light handling of sharp materials, while an A9 glove is designed for maximum protection in high-risk environments.

Additional Features
Some modern cut-resistant gloves come with added features like:
– Nonslip Grips: Ideal for handling tools or wet materials.
– Touchscreen Compatibility: Useful for workers who need to use devices without removing their gloves.
– Reinforced Palms: Provides additional durability where wear and tear occur most.

Maintenance Tips for Cut-Resistant Gloves
To prolong the lifespan of cut-resistant gloves and maintain their protective capabilities, proper care and maintenance are crucial.
– Regular Inspection: Check for signs of wear, tear, and damage. Any gloves that show significant wear should be replaced immediately.
– Cleaning: Follow the manufacturer’s instructions for cleaning. Generally, both handwashing and machine washing with mild detergent is acceptable.
– Storage: Store gloves in a clean, dry place away from direct sunlight to prevent degradation of the aramid fibers.
